It’s been five weeks since AEW’s television debut and the show is proving to be a smash. AEW Dynamite has already garnered high ratings along with praise from fans. So what does AEW’s EVP Cody Rhodes have to say about the show’s success?
During an interview with ESPN’s Cheap Heat, Rhodes was asked to grade AEW Dynamite. Here’s what he had to say:
“I would give it an A. I’d say four of the five shows, I would give an A+. I only say that because the execution is the main thing, we have to execute and we have this long form plan, and we had been planning this for quite some time, and it’s a lot more traditional booking vs. writing, and with traditional booking, you’re going backwards from these major events, so I have to stop being a fan on a regular basis when it comes to Dynamite itself, when it comes to TV, I’m honored everything that happens. I’m honored that I have a chair for myself in the go position, that I have my own headset, I’m honored that I have my own office, all these little things, I have to stop caring about, and just say, ‘Ok, cool, that’s great, now let’s validate why these things exist.'”
